**“We enable greatness in people and organizations everywhere.** ” FranklinCovey (NYSE: FC) is the workplace of choice for _Achievers with Heart_ . We are one of the largest and most trusted leadership companies in the world, with directly owned and licensee partner offices in over 160 countries and territories. With more than 2,000 global associates, FranklinCovey transforms organizations by partnering with clients to build leaders, teams, and cultures that get breakthrough results through collective action. Our services and products are primarily delivered through our subscription offerings, which are comprised of the FranklinCovey All Access Pass , which is primarily sold through our Enterprise Division, and the _Leader_ _in Me_ membership, which is designed specifically for our Education Division. Enterprise clients include _Fortune 100_ ,  _Fortune 500_ , thousands of small and mid-sized businesses, and numerous government entities. FranklinCovey Education has shared our programs, books, and content with thousands of public and private primary, secondary, and post-secondary schools and institutions.
